AECOM’s Water Business Line is seeking a talented and experienced Senior Technical Lead in Conveyance to lead our growing Pipeline Design Practice, with a home base in New England. We are looking for an enthusiastic and highly-motivated team member to work on a variety of water distribution, wastewater collection, and stormwater treatment and conveyance projects as a Technical Lead. It is expected that this role will provide support to projects throughout the Northeast US. The position is flexible between our Boston MA, Chelmsford MA, Rocky Hill CT or Providence RI office and is a hybrid position.
The ideal candidate will have extensive experience in large diameter conveyance pipelines for water, wastewater, and/or stormwater design, analysis, installation, inspection, and leak detection in dense urban settings. The preferred candidate will be energetic and have a proven ability to lead a team of engineers and designers to deliver successful projects.
This position offers a unique opportunity to work within an established and successful local and national group that offers a diverse range of technical challenges and career development opportunities. You will interact throughout AECOM and externally with clients to conceptualize and develop conveyance infrastructure that is reliable, sustainable, and resilient. You will be involved in all phases of the project delivery and will be engaged in assessing industry trends and participate in professional organizations for marketing, industry recognition, and networking opportunities.
